Title: Regarding turning off scientific notation when downloading as csv
Post by: asmfloyd on 09 Feb 2021 11:42:36 AM
Hello,
  I am generating a report in which one column has a bigger number (12 digits). When downloaded and opened in csv, excel shows that as scientific notation . Is there any option I can do in Cognos report studio so that it does not display in scientific notation?

 Excel displays big numbers in scientific notation because it's a default Excel behavior.

The only way I can think of to get around that is to get Cognos to place the number inside quotes, making it a text value instead of a number.

I tried a few things to get quotes around a number in CSV, but didn't come up with anything that worked in the few minutes I spent playing with it.
